University of Leicester Ranking and Address
University of Leicester Information The University of Leicester ranking is 19th in the University Review best UK universities list. Similarly ranked colleges include UEA, Bristol, Southampton, and York. When you take a look at all of the different universities that are available for undergraduate and graduate studies in the United Kingdom, there are a few that …